Understanding the Game Selection at New Online Casinos
The heart of any online casino is its game selection. Players want variety and a constant stream of new content to keep them engaged. A strong casino will offer a wide array of options, including classic table games, modern video slots, live dealer experiences, and sometimes even sports betting integration. The quality of these games is equally important. Players are looking for visually appealing graphics, smooth gameplay, and fair odds. Many casinos partner with leading software providers, like NetEnt, Microgaming, and Playtech, to ensure a high-quality gaming experience. These providers are known for their innovative game designs, robust security protocols, and regularly audited random number generators (RNGs), which guarantee fair outcomes. A casino with a limited library or games from less reputable providers might signal a lack of investment and commitment to player satisfaction.
Beyond the sheer quantity of games, the availability of different game categories is important. Some players prefer the strategic complexities of poker or blackjack, while others enjoy the simple excitement of slot machines. A good casino will cater to all preferences. Live dealer games, in particular, have become increasingly popular, as they offer the immersive experience of a brick-and-mortar casino without having to leave home. These games are streamed live from a studio, with a real dealer interacting with players in real-time. The inclusion of progressive jackpot slots is another attractive feature, as these games offer the potential for life-changing wins.

| Game Category | Typical Return to Player (RTP) |
|---|---|
| Video Slots | 95% – 98% |
| Blackjack | 99% – 99.5% (with optimal strategy) |
| Roulette (European) | 97.3% |
| Baccarat | 98.9% (Banker bet) |

Bonuses and Promotions: A Vital Attraction
Online casinos heavily rely on bonuses and promotions to attract new players and retain existing ones. These offers can range from welcome bonuses, which are awarded upon registration, to reload bonuses, free spins, and loyalty programs. Welcome bonuses are often the most substantial, offering a percentage match on a player's first deposit or a set amount of free credits. However, it’s crucial to read the terms and conditions associated with any bonus, as they often come with wagering requirements. Wagering requirements specify the amount a player must bet before they can withdraw any winnings earned from the bonus. These requirements can vary significantly, and some can be quite difficult to meet. A casino with overly restrictive wagering requirements might be a red flag. Furthermore, players should be aware of any game restrictions associated with bonuses. Some casinos may limit the games that can be played with bonus funds.
Beyond welcome bonuses, ongoing promotions are essential for keeping players engaged. These can include daily or weekly bonuses, cash back offers, and tournaments with substantial prize pools. Loyalty programs are another common feature, rewarding players for their continued patronage with points that can be redeemed for bonuses, free spins, or other perks. A well-structured loyalty program can significantly enhance the player experience and encourage long-term engagement. Transparency in bonus terms and conditions is paramount. Players should be able to easily understand the rules and requirements before accepting any offer.

Security and Licensing: Ensuring a Safe Gaming Environment
Security is paramount when it comes to online gambling. Players are entrusting casinos with their personal and financial information, so it’s essential that these platforms employ robust security measures to protect it. This includes using encryption technology, such as SSL (Secure Socket Layer), to encrypt all data transmitted between the player's computer and the casino's servers. Casinos should also have firewalls and intrusion detection systems in place to prevent unauthorized access to their systems. Furthermore, reputable casinos undergo regular security audits by independent third-party organizations to verify the effectiveness of their security measures. These audits assess everything from the casino's software to its data storage practices.
In addition to security measures, it’s crucial that casinos are properly licensed and regulated. Licensing ensures that the casino operates legally and adheres to certain standards of fairness and transparency. Licensing jurisdictions vary, but some of the most reputable include the Malta Gaming Authority (MGA), the UK Gambling Commission (UKGC), and the Curacao eGaming. Players can typically find information about a casino's licensing on its website. A valid license is a strong indication that the casino is trustworthy and operates legally. It also provides players with recourse in the event of a dispute.
Responsible Gambling Features
A responsible casino prioritizes the well-being of its players and offers tools to help them manage their gambling habits. These tools can include deposit limits, loss limits, session time limits, and self-exclusion options. Deposit limits allow players to set a maximum amount that they can deposit into their account within a given timeframe. Loss limits allow players to set a maximum amount that they can lose within a given timeframe. Session time limits allow players to set a maximum amount of time that they can spend gambling in a single session. Self-exclusion options allow players to voluntarily exclude themselves from gambling for a specified period of time.

Customer Support and Payment Options
Effective customer support is critical for a positive gaming experience. Players may encounter questions or issues at any time, and they need to be able to get assistance quickly and efficiently. The best casinos offer multiple support channels, including live chat, email, and phone support. Live chat is often the preferred method, as it provides instant assistance. Email support is useful for more complex issues, while phone support can be helpful for players who prefer to speak to a representative directly. Regardless of the channel, support agents should be knowledgeable, friendly, and responsive.
Payment options are another important consideration. Players want to be able to deposit and withdraw funds easily and securely. Reputable casinos offer a variety of payment methods, including credit cards, debit cards, e-wallets (such as PayPal, Skrill, and Neteller), bank transfers, and sometimes even cryptocurrencies. Withdrawal times can vary depending on the payment method, but players generally expect to receive their winnings in a timely manner. Casinos should also have clear policies regarding withdrawal limits and fees. A transparent and efficient payment process is vital for building trust with players.
